Abstract :
Summary form only given, as follows. A method for calculating the interaction of a microwave with a plane layer of a magnetoactive low-pressure plasma is presented. In this paper, the plasma layer is situated between a plane dielectric layer and a plane metal screen. The calculation model contains the microwave energy balance, particle balance and electron energy balance. The numerical calculations of the nonlinear interaction of the incident plane microwave and the plane plasma layer show that there are hysteresis phenomena when the external magnetic field and intensity of the incident microwave are changed. The cause of these hysteresis phenomena is considered. As a result of this investigation, the estimations for conditions of the plasma uniformity near the surface being worked in a real microwave plasmatron for giant integrated circuits and printed technology have been considered.
